Mike Sando of The Athletic shared that one NFL executive warned the Jets about continuing to repeat the same mistakes over and over again when it comes to roster building. But what is this repeated issue for the Jets' rosters over the years? NFL exec warns Jets about repeating same mistakes over and over again "The Jets keep doing the same thing," one NFL exec said.

"They trade good players off their team, they get draft picks, nobody wants to play there, they are a young team, they have to find a journeyman quarterback. Then they bring in all these picks, they can't find a quarterback still, and then they trade all those players for more picks and still can't find a quarterback. " This seemingly endless downward spiral is something the Jets have been trapped in for a while now, and most recently can be seen by the roster moves from Aaron Glenn and Darren Mougey in the past year.
